SPRING 2020 Season Update as of May 1, 2020

Posted by Cherokee Senior Softball Association on May 01 2020 at 07:35PM PDT in Spring 2020

Due to ongoing COVID-19 concerns, Cherokee Recreation & Parks Agency (CRPA) has decided to completely cancel the Spring 2020 Adult athletic season. Please see below the letter notification received from CRPA to CSSA dated April 27, 2020.
We at CSSA are very disappointed that we will be unable to have some of our SPRING 2020 games played after the recent easing/lifting of the Shelter in Place recommendations this week by Governor Kemp. As everyone knows, this pandemic is something that none of us have ever experienced, thus there is no schedule, nor histories for any of us to follow, nor refer to.
If you have further questions, please send Norm Thiem a message, email etc., and he will get with you asap.

Actual letter from CSSA -
“Good Afternoon Everyone,
Thank you for your patience while we were trying to find a way to continue with the spring adult athletic season. Unfortunately, due to the ongoing COVID-19 concerns, the State of Georgia recommendations, and the facility closures around Georgia for the foreseeable future, CRPA has decided to cancel the spring 2020 athletic season. This decision was not an easy one, but one that ultimately had to be made for the safety of our participants and staff. The health and well-being of our community is of the utmost importance to us and will remain our highest priority.

We appreciate your participation and support of Cherokee Recreation & Parks and the programs we provide for the community.

Let’s stay safe and optimistic that we will be playing again in our parks very soon!
